Abstract

The utility model discloses an even asphalt spraying device, and relates to the technical field of road construction. The utility model comprises an asphalt carrying structure and a spraying mechanism, wherein the front surface of the asphalt carrying structure is fixedly connected with the spraying mechanism; the spraying mechanism comprises a hydraulic pusher, a connecting plate, a rotating column, a motor and an extension spraying frame, wherein the upper end of a push rod of the hydraulic pusher is fixedly connected with the connecting plate through a bolt, the other end of the connecting plate is rotationally connected with a bearing inside the rotating column, the bottom of the rotating column is movably connected with the motor, and the front side of the upper end of the rotating column is fixedly connected with the extension spraying frame. The utility model solves the problems of low working efficiency and large workload of workers of the uniform asphalt spraying device through the asphalt carrying structure and the spraying mechanism.

Background
Asphalt is a black brown complex mixture composed of hydrocarbon compounds with different molecular weights and nonmetallic derivatives thereof, is one of high-viscosity organic liquids, mostly exists in the form of asphalt or tar, and has black surface, and is mainly divided into coal tar asphalt, petroleum asphalt and natural asphalt, and is used for industries such as paint, plastics, rubber and the like, paving pavements and the like. When the pavement of the pavement is carried out, the asphalt sprayer is usually required to be used for uniformly spraying the liquid asphalt on the broken stone pavement, but when the asphalt sprayer is used for spraying the asphalt, the direction of a spray head is generally controlled by manually holding a spray boom, and the manual control mode is generally required, so that the spraying effect is easily affected, the working efficiency is relatively low, and the workload is also large.

Detailed Description
The technical solutions in the embodiments of the present utility model will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present utility model.
Referring to fig. 1-3, the utility model discloses an asphalt uniform spraying device, which comprises an asphalt carrying structure 1 and a spraying mechanism 2, wherein the front surface of the asphalt carrying structure 1 is fixedly connected with the spraying mechanism 2;
the spraying mechanism 2 comprises a hydraulic pusher 201, a connecting plate 202, a rotating column 203, a motor 204 and an extension spraying frame 205, wherein the upper end of a push rod of the hydraulic pusher 201 is fixedly connected with the connecting plate 202 through a bolt, the other end of the connecting plate 202 is rotationally connected with a bearing in the rotating column 203, the bottom of the rotating column 203 is movably connected with the motor 204, and the front side of the upper end of the rotating column 203 is fixedly connected with the extension spraying frame 205;
the hydraulic pusher 201 is fixed in the right end of the fixed beam 104, the upper end of the push rod is fixed with the connecting plate 202 through bolts, the connecting plate 202 is connected with the bearing in the rotary column 203, the rotary column 203 and the extension spray frame 205 can be pulled up and down by the arrangement of the hydraulic pusher 201 and the connecting plate 202 without influencing the rotation of the rotary column 203, the adjustment of the asphalt spraying height can be carried out, the bottom of the rotary column 203 is connected with the motor 204 through the connecting component, the rotatable bearing is positioned in the rotary column, the upper end of the side surface of the rotary column is fixed with the extension spray frame 205 for connecting the hydraulic pusher 201, the motor 204 and the extension spray frame 205 to form a linkage working relationship, the motor 204 is fixed in the middle of the beam body of the fixed beam 104, the shaft of the motor 204 is connected with the rotary column 203 through the telescopic connecting component, the rotary spraying device is used for carrying out rotary driving on the rotary column 203 and the extension spraying frame 205 so as to realize the change of the asphalt spraying direction, the extension spraying frame 205 is of an extensible support structure, the rear end of the rotary spraying frame is fixed with the rotary column 203, the front end face of the rotary spraying frame is fixedly connected with a spray head 206, uniform speed spraying of asphalt in different radiuses can be carried out under the driving of a motor 204, manual operation and control are not needed, the working effect can be ensured, the workload of workers can be greatly reduced, the adjustment of the asphalt spraying height, direction and coverage radius can be realized rapidly and conveniently through the arrangement of the hydraulic pusher 201, the connecting plate 202, the rotary column 203, the motor 204 and the extension spraying frame 205, the asphalt spraying effect can be ensured, the asphalt spraying efficiency can be further improved, and the practicability and applicability are stronger.
1-2, the asphalt carrying structure 1 comprises a storage box 101, a push handle 102, a bottom vehicle 103 and a fixed beam 104, wherein the push handle 102 is fixedly connected to the back surface and the left side surface of the storage box 101, the storage box 101 is fixedly connected to the rear side of the upper surface of the bottom vehicle 103, and the front surface of the storage box 101 is fixedly connected with the fixed beam 104;
the storage box 101 is the box structure of pitch storage, and its below is fixed at the upper surface of end car 103 through bolt and rubbing board for carry out the storage to pitch, for the spraying of pitch provides the raw materials, end car 103 is pitch sprinkler's bottom carrying structure, is used for carrying out pitch and spraying mechanism 2's convenient transportation, and fixed beam 104 fixed connection is at storage box 101 positive intermediate position, is spraying mechanism 2 connection and the structure of support.
As shown in fig. 1 and 3, the spraying mechanism 2 further comprises a spray nozzle 206 and a pressure pump 207, the spray nozzle 206 is fixedly connected to the front end surface of the extending spray rack 205, and the spray nozzle 206 is connected and communicated with the pressure pump 207 through a pipeline; the pressure pump 207 is fixedly connected to the front side of the upper surface of the bottom car 103; the pressure pump 207 is fixedly connected and communicated with the storage tank 101 through a rear interface; the hydraulic pusher 201 and the motor 204 are fixedly connected to the right end and the middle position inside the fixed beam 104 respectively;
the pressure pump 207 is a pressure pumping device, and is fixed on the upper surface of the bottom vehicle 103 through bolts, the input interface is fixedly communicated with the storage tank 101, and the output interface is connected with the spray nozzle 206 through a pipeline for pressure conveying of asphalt, so that asphalt can be normally sprayed out through the spray nozzle 206.
One specific application of this embodiment is: when the device is used, firstly, asphalt is put into the storage box through the input port on the upper surface of the storage box 101, then the device can be pushed to move to a designated position, when spraying at the designated position, firstly, the hydraulic pusher 201 is controlled to push or pull the connecting plate 202 upwards and downwards, so that the connecting plate 202 drives the rotating column 203, the extending spray frame 205 and the spray head 206 to move upwards and downwards, in the process, the connecting assembly between the motor 204 and the rotating column 203 can synchronously extend upwards and downwards, so as to change the spraying height of the spray head 206, after the height is adjusted, the extending spray frame 205 can be pulled or pushed backwards, the coverable spraying radius of the spray head 206 is changed, and then the motor 204 can be started to rotate and drive the rotating column 203 and the extending spray frame 205, so that the spray head 206 can spray the ground at a uniform speed.
